Output e0521ec4a305a8f742ecd7a55198070c275b7bdbb47d1ac3ce6f3e1d39bca81e:0

value
22812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ce4fc7712da1ea91e8c987ff5de5080ea5ea4c OP_EQUAL
address
36bWtVe82Ls3QARrx7jaKRvJ4wuvhfKnqr
transaction
e0521ec4a305a8f742ecd7a55198070c275b7bdbb47d1ac3ce6f3e1d39bca81e